Transaction 1054177063bd8d8156fe62673f7be704afbfa01d51149414d55756ee9e134095
1 Input
2 Outputs
- 1054177063bd8d8156fe62673f7be704afbfa01d51149414d55756ee9e134095:0
- 1054177063bd8d8156fe62673f7be704afbfa01d51149414d55756ee9e134095:1
value 108350
address 34712BDfEeaDMx1j6PsZ8c97LwiAJ3jGTi
value 3576477
address 1MYkcNyCtPmxivKoMy5v5VBkv6LuBrgrAy